> My opinion would be that SDL support should *not* be removed.
>
> My laptop has an i5 with the Intel graphics. I can't use OpenGL with
> Shotcut because it requires OpenGl 2.2 and the chipset in my laptop only
> supports 2.1. I personally expect that there will be plenty of people in
> the world who are happily editing SD content on an older machine who will
> no longer be able to use KDENLIVE when they upgrade.
>
> It seems premature to me.

> I don't know how stable it is but Steinar merged his code into
> kdenlive/master and dropped support for SDL what
> makes current HEAD unusable who use the build script. It compiles but on
> starting movit is not found and kdenlive exits. Perhaps I should
> write to Steinar but it seems that he wants to do it "stable" asap.
